Для обмена данными на шине USB используется транзакция - группа из нескольких пакетов, рассмотренных ранее. Основные транзакции состоят из трех пакетов: маркера, данных и подтверждения. Маркер содержит адрес ведомого устройства и команду. Во втором пакете передаются данные. Третий пакет подтверждает правильность приема данных или сообщает об ошибке в них. Каждый пакет состоит из заголовка и тела, защищенных контрольной суммой и завершается сигналом ЕОР. Список всех лекций на сайте автора в описании канала.
Негізгі бет лекция 314. Транзакции на шине USB
Пікірлер: 5